教学前端设计
前端设计是指通过HTML、CSS和JavaScript等技术实现的网页界面设计。它关注用户界面的设计和用户体验,以及与后端开发相结合,完成网页的基本功能和交互效果。在这篇文章中,我将介绍前端设计的基础知识和实用技巧。
首先,了解HTML、CSS和JavaScript是前端设计的基础。HTML是超文本标记语言,用于构建网页的结构和内容。CSS是层叠样式表,用于美化和布局网页的外观。JavaScript是一种脚本语言,用于实现网页的动态效果和交互功能。掌握这三种技术对于成为一名合格的前端设计师至关重要。
在开始设计前端界面之前,我们首先需要分析网站或应用的需求和目标用户。这将帮助我们确定整体的风格和布局,并决定我们使用的彩、字体和图像等元素。一个好的前端设计应该符合目标用户的需求,并给用户带来良好的用户体验。
javascript属于前端吗
对于前端设计,良好的用户体验是至关重要的。我们可以通过考虑以下几点来提高用户体验。首先,设计简洁直观的界面。避免使用太多复杂的视觉效果和设计元素,让用户更容易
理解和使用界面。其次,保持页面的加载速度快。用户不愿意等待过长时间加载页面,因此需要优化网页的性能和加载速度。再次,考虑响应式设计。随着移动设备的普及,确保网页在不同尺寸的屏幕上都能良好地展现,可以提供更好的用户体验。
在进行前端设计时,我们还需要考虑网站的可访问性。可访问性是指所有用户,包括身体上有残疾或使用辅助技术的用户,都能够方便地访问网站。我们可以通过使用有意义的标签和语义化的HTML来提高网站的可访问性。另外,设置合适的Alt属性、有意义的链接文本和键盘可访问性等也是有助于提高网站可访问性的做法。
当我们设计网站时,还需要关注网页的排版和布局。合理的排版和布局可以提高用户对内容的理解,提升用户体验。我们可以使用CSS的网格布局、弹性布局等技术来实现网页的自适应布局,以适应不同设备的屏幕尺寸。
此外,还可以使用动画和过渡效果增添用户界面的交互和吸引力。通过使用CSS的transition和animation属性,我们可以实现平滑的过渡和动画效果,为用户带来更好的用户体验。但是记住要适度使用动画效果,避免过多的动画效果导致页面加载缓慢或用户分心。
另外,考虑网站的兼容性也是前端设计的重要考虑因素。不同的浏览器可能对HTML、CSS和JavaScript的解析和渲染有所不同,因此我们需要进行兼容性测试,并根据不同浏览器的需求进行调整和优化。
最后,为了提高自己的前端设计能力,我们可以参考一些优秀的前端设计作品和学习资源。如W3School、MDN等网站提供了大量的前端设计教程和实例,我们可以通过这些资源不断学习和实践,提升自己的设计技巧和能力。
总结来说,前端设计是通过HTML、CSS和JavaScript等技术实现网页界面设计的过程。我们需要了解这些基础知识,并将其应用于实际的设计中。关注用户体验、可访问性和网页排版布局是提高前端设计质量的关键因素。同时,不断学习和实践也是提升自己前端设计能力的重要途径。
(总字数:782字)

版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。